How our sorting works

The order in which job vacancies are displayed is determined by a composite score based on the following factors:

  • Keyword Relevance: How well your search terms match the vacancy details. We prioritize matches found in the job title, followed by job requirements, location names, and educational levels. Matches within general employer information or the organization's name carry a lower weight.
  • Commercial Prioritization (Premium Jobs): Vacancies paid for by employers ('Premium' or 'Sponsored') receive a ranking boost and will appear higher in the search results.
  • Recency (Date Relevance): Newer vacancies are prioritized. The relevance score of a vacancy is reduced by half once the posting is older than 30 days.
  • Proximity (Distance Relevance): Vacancies located closer to your search location are ranked higher. For vacancies located more than 30 km from the search center, the relevance score is halved.
The final ranking is established by multiplying all these individual factors to calculate the total relevance score.

    Electrical Contracts Manager

    East & South East London

    £80,000 - £90,000 + Car Allowance + Travel + Pension + Private Healthcare

    Are you an experienced Electrical Contracts Manager looking for a role that offers genuine autonomy, flexibility, and the opportunity to deliver major projects with a highly respected M&E contractor?

    Our client is a well-established and financially secure Building Services contractor with an annual turnover of approximately £60m. They have built an excellent reputation for delivering high-quality Mechanical & Electrical projects across the Commercial, Industrial and Care Home sectors, with individual project values reaching up to £5m M&E.

    Due to continued growth and a strong order book, they are looking to appoint an Electrical Contracts Manager to take ownership of two flagship projects located across East and South East London, with a combined M&E value of approximately £6m.

    The Role

    As Electrical Contracts Manager, you will be responsible for the successful delivery of both projects from a commercial, operational and programme perspective.

    This is a senior-level position where you will oversee project teams on site while maintaining close communication with clients, consultants and senior management.

    Key responsibilities include:

    Managing the electrical delivery of two live projects valued at £6m combined
    Leading and supporting Project Managers and Site Managers across both sites
    Ensuring projects are delivered safely, on programme and within budget
    Maintaining strong client relationships throughout project lifecycles
    Monitoring labour resources, subcontractor performance and procurement schedules
    Attending progress meetings and providing regular project updates
    Driving quality standards and ensuring successful project handovers

    The Person

    We are keen to speak with experienced Electrical Contracts Managers who have:

    Proven experience delivering M&E or electrical projects within the commercial, industrial or healthcare/care home sectors
    A strong track record managing projects valued between £2m - £10m
    Experience overseeing Project Managers and Site Management teams
    Excellent client-facing and leadership skills
    Strong commercial awareness and programme management capability
    A proactive, hands-on approach with the ability to work autonomously

    What's on Offer?

    £80,000 - £90,000 basic salary
    Car allowance
    Travel expenses
    Private healthcare
    Company pension scheme
    Hybrid working arrangement
    3 days per week on site
    2 days per week working remotely
    Long-term career progression with a growing and highly respected contractor
    Immediate start available
